WebWatch officialfre3's clip titled "DAY 9 OF 30" Web22 mrt. 2024 · The general recommendation for a healthy temperature range for goldfish is 68-74˚F. However, common-type goldfish can thrive in water as cool as 62˚F or so, and usually do best in water that is 72˚F or below. Fancy goldfish cannot tolerate the same cool temperatures that common goldfish can, so they usually prefer 68˚F as the temperature ...

Web19 apr. 2024 · All fish are cold-blooded, which is also called ectothermic. This means that fish are unable to regulate their body temperature, relying solely on the outside environment for temperature regulation.
